Position Objectives: * Ensure the successful planning, execution, and closure of corporate technology projects aligned with the organization’s strategic goals, guaranteeing adherence to scope, schedule, budget, and quality, as well as effective risk management and stakeholder communication. **Key Responsibilities:** 1\. Define and Plan Projects * Develop scope, objectives, deliverables, and schedules. * Estimate resources, costs, and budget. * Select the appropriate methodology (agile, traditional, hybrid). 2\. Coordinate Teams and Resources * Assign tasks and responsibilities. * Manage availability of internal and external resources. * Foster collaboration across departments and with vendors. 3\. Manage Risks and Changes * Identify potential risks and define mitigation plans. * Control changes to scope, schedule, and cost through formal processes. 4\. Monitor and Control Progress * Track schedule, budget, and quality. * Use KPIs and project management tools to report progress. * Detect deviations and implement corrective actions. 5\. Communication and Stakeholder Management * Keep stakeholders informed about progress, risks, and decisions. * Prepare executive reports and presentations for senior management. * Manage expectations and resolve conflicts. 6\. Project Closure and Evaluation * Validate deliverables and ensure achievement of objectives. * Document lessons learned and produce final reports. * Transfer knowledge to operational teams.
